Goal |
Goal 15: Protect, restore and promote sustainable use of terrestrial ecosystems, sustainably manage forests, combat desertification, and halt and reverse land degradation and halt biodiversity loss |
---|---|
Target |
Target 15.4: By 2030, ensure the conservation of mountain ecosystems, including their biodiversity, in order to enhance their capacity to provide benefits that are essential for sustainable development |
Indicator |
Indicator 15.4.2:: (a) Mountain Green Cover Index and (b) proportion of degraded mountain land |
Definition and concepts |
Sub-indicator 15.4.2a, Mountain Green Cover Index (MGCI), is designed to measure the extent and changes
of green cover - i.e. forest, shrubs, trees, pasture land, cropland, etc. – in mountain areas. MGCI is defined
as the percentage of green cover over the total surface of the mountain area of a given country and for
given reporting year. The aim of the index is to monitor the evolution of green cover and thus assess the
status of conservation of mountain ecosystems. |
